    The main motivation of the present paper is to design a statistically well justified and biologically compatible neural network model and to suggest a theoretical interpretation of the high parallelism of biological neural networks. We consider a probabilistic approach to neural networks in the framework of statistical pattern recognition. The complete method based on EM algorithm has been applied to recognize unconstrained handwritten numerals from the database of the Concordia University Montreal.
